According to the press release, J L Stream is available in India and most countries around the world, offering streamers an opportunity to showcase their talent in any language, any time, and receive revenue. Therefore, payments integrated into J L Stream app support three main types of transactions:
In-app purchase of coins by J L Stream users (supported by Rapyd Collect);
Users sending gifts to broadcasters whose content they enjoy as a form of appreciation (developed in-house);
Streamers or broadcasters cashing out gifts with their preferred payment methods (supported by Rapyd Disburse).
Overall, thanks to Rapyd's Collect and Disburse solutions, along with the Rapyd Global Payments Network, J L Stream offers its users a localised payment experience on the app, enables streamers to get paid, and reduces J L Stream's costs compared to building its own global payment infrastructure.
Furthermore, Rapyd Collect allows J L Stream to accept payments from users around the world in their locally-preferred way – including bank transfers and Netbanking, local e-wallets, and credit or debit cards. Indian consumers, for example, can pay with UPI, Netbanking, any Indian debit or credit card, and most ewallets including Paytm and PhonePe when they consume live stream or play games on J L Stream. Besides, Rapyd Disburse enables J L Stream's streamers to get paid in their bank accounts in their respective home countries.
The initiative comes as COVID-19 has further boosted the consumption of digital content among Indians. According to KPMG, Indian consumers are likely to form new habits resulting in increased consumption of OTT content and online gaming even after COVID-19 comes under control.
